java - Java中int转String的高效方法

标签 java performance

Integer.toString(int);

String.valueOf(int);

上述两种方法中,哪一种是将 int 转换为 String 的有效方法?

提前致谢。

最佳答案

String.valueOf 调用 Integer.toString,所以我想您可能会争辩说 Integer.toString 稍微更有效。

编辑:使用现代编译器,调用将被内联,因此两者之间应该没有任何区别。对于一个古老的编译器,差异应该仍然可以忽略不计。

关于java - Java中int转String的高效方法,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4405407/

相关文章:

sql-server - 在 SQL Server 中查询最小值比查询所有行要长很多

python - 查询大的海龟文件

java - Android 4.4.2 Issue : javax.net.ssl.SSLHandshakeException : Failure in SSL library, 通常是协议(protocol)错误

java - Java中Enum对应的BiFunctional函数如何实现?

java - Android(Java)中另一个 jar 里的一个 jar

Javascript 数组 100000 x 100000 - 杀死我的浏览器

sql-server - 高性能 SQL Server 数据库设计资源

java - HSQLDB 和 SequenceGenerator 的问题

java - Glassfish 和 JBoss 5 的真实世界比较?

php - 查询性能的最佳实践是什么?